The vacancy-ordered phases known as τ-phases were described, and published results on the stacking sequences observed were reviewed. It was shown that the stacking sequences along the 3-fold axis could be derived from a projection method which involved projection onto an axis of type, [rrq]. The structure had alternating filled and empty lamellae parallel to planes of type, (rrq). The particular cases in which r and q were consecutive numbers of the Fibonacci sequence could be regarded as rational approximants to a 1-dimensional quasi-periodic structure. Mathematical properties of the sequences, and their relationship to 3-dimensional structures, were presented.
Stacking Sequences and Symmetry Properties of Trigonal Vacancy-Ordered Phases (τ Phases). E.A.Lord, S.Ranganathan, A.Subramaniam: Philosophical Magazine A, 2002, 82[2], 255-68
